Home Start Back Next End
  
29
2.1.6.2
Struktur Dasar Algoritma Genetika
Menurut,
Thiang,dkk(2001) struktur dasar algoritma
genetika adalah sebagai
berikut :
1.  Membangkitkan populasi awal
populasi awal
ini dibangkitkan secara random sehingga didapatkan solusi
awal.
Populasi
itu
sendiri
terdiri atas
sejumlah
kromosom
yang
merepresentasikan solusi yang diinginkan.
2.  Membentuk generasi baru
Untuk membentuk generasi baru, digunakan operator reproduksi/seleksi,
crossover dan mutasi. Proses ini dilakukan berulang-ulang sehingga
didapatkan
jumlah
kromosom
yang
cukup
untuk
membentuk
generasi
baru
di
mana
generasi
baru
ini
merupakan representasi dari solusi baru.
Generasi baru ini dikenal dengan istilah anak (offspring).
3.   Evaluasi solusi
Pada
tiap
generasi,
kromosom akan
melalui
proses
evaluasi
dengan
menggunakan
alat
ukur
yang
dinamakan fitness.
Nilai
fitness
suatu
kromosom menggambarkan
kualitas
kromosom
dalam populasi
tersebut.
Proses ini akan mengevaluasi setiap populasi dengan menghitung nilai
fitness setiap kromosom dan mengevaluasinya sampai terpenuhi kriteria
berhenti.
Bila
kriteria
berhenti
belum terpenuhi
maka
akan
dibentuk
lagi
generasi baru dengan mengulangi langkah kedua. Beberapa kriteria
berhenti 
yang 
sering 
digunakan 
antara 
lain: 
berhenti 
pada 
generasi
Word to PDF Converter | Word to HTML Converter